作为一名网络工程师,我经常遇到用户反馈:“我的手机一开VPN就断网!”这个问题看似简单,实则涉及多个层面的网络配置、系统机制和运营商策略,今天我们就从技术原理出发,深入分析原因,并提供切实可行的解决方案。

我们需要明确一个关键点:手机连接VPN时断网,通常不是因为VPN本身“坏掉”,而是由于网络路径被重定向或策略冲突导致,常见的原因包括以下几种:

  1. 默认路由被劫持
    当你启用VPN时,设备会自动创建一个新的虚拟网卡(如TAP/TUN),并修改系统的默认路由表,将所有流量转发到VPN服务器,如果这个过程出错——比如VPN客户端没有正确设置“分流规则”(Split Tunneling)——就会导致本地网络不通,尤其是当你访问国内网站时,流量可能被错误地路由到国外服务器,造成延迟甚至超时。

  2. DNS污染或解析失败
    有些劣质VPN服务使用自定义DNS,但未正确配置,或者在切换网络环境(如从Wi-Fi切换到移动数据)时未同步更新DNS,这会导致域名无法解析,表现为“无法上网”,即使物理连接正常。

  3. 运营商防火墙拦截(GFW)
    在中国等地区,部分运营商对特定端口(如OpenVPN的UDP 1194)或加密协议进行深度包检测(DPI),一旦检测到异常流量,可能会直接阻断连接,导致断网,这种现象常见于某些免费或不合规的VPN服务。

  4. 系统权限限制或后台进程冲突
    Android/iOS系统对VPN权限有严格控制,如果应用未获取必要权限(如网络状态监听),或与其他安全软件(如杀毒工具、防火墙App)发生冲突,也可能导致连接中断。

如何解决呢?以下是实用建议:

✅ 检查并启用“分流模式”:在VPN客户端中选择“仅代理特定应用”或“智能分流”,避免全流量走VPN,保留本地网络访问能力。

✅ 更换协议和端口:尝试使用更隐蔽的协议(如WireGuard、Obfsproxy)或非标准端口(如443端口),绕过运营商检测。

✅ 手动配置DNS:在手机设置中手动指定可靠的DNS(如1.1.1.1或8.8.8.8),避免依赖VPN自带DNS。

✅ 更新固件与APP:确保手机操作系统和VPN客户端均为最新版本,修复已知兼容性问题。

✅ 使用企业级工具:对于频繁出现断网的用户,建议部署支持MPLS或SD-WAN的企业级解决方案,实现多线路冗余和智能选路。

“手机开VPN就断网”并非无解之谜,通过理解其背后的技术逻辑,结合合理配置与工具选择,大多数问题都能迎刃而解,作为网络工程师,我建议用户优先选用正规渠道提供的服务,并保持良好的网络习惯——毕竟,稳定才是真正的自由。

手机开启VPN后断网问题的深度解析与解决方案  第1张

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速